Akr1c6 - aldo-keto reductase family 1, member C6 Gene
Also Known as Akr1c1; Hsd17b5; 3alpha-HSD
Species: Mus musculus
Summary
Enables estradiol 17-beta-dehydrogenase activity. Acts upstream of or within negative regulation of mRNA splicing, via spliceosome and steroid metabolic process. Predicted to be located in cytoplasm and nucleus. Predicted to be active in cytosol. Is expressed in several structures, including alimentary system; liver and biliary system; lung; metanephros; and sensory organ. Human ortholog(s) of this gene implicated in 46,XY sex reversal 8; B-lymphoblastic leukemia/lymphoma; T-cell acute lymphoblastic leukemia; and leukemia. Orthologous to several human genes including AKR1C1 (aldo-keto reductase family 1 member C1) and AKR1C3 (aldo-keto reductase family 1 member C3). [provided by Alliance of Genome Resources, Apr 2022]
